数据可视化工具:Matplotlib、Bokeh与ggplot2的使用指南
在数据科学领域,可视化是理解和呈现数据的重要手段。本文将介绍几种常用的可视化工具,包括Matplotlib、Bokeh和R语言中的ggplot2,并详细讲解它们的基本使用方法、图形修改以及交互控制等内容。
1. Matplotlib的使用
1.1 初始图形绘制
在使用新模块时,检查其是否正常工作是很有必要的。从IPython命令行执行以下命令:
In [2]: x = randn(90000)
In [3]: hist(x, 300)
执行上述代码后,命令行可能会输出两种内容:
- 两个数组和一个列表( hist 调用的返回值)
- 一个堆栈跟踪信息(当删除 ~/.cache/matplotlib/fontList*.cache 中的Matplotlib字体缓存时,该信息会消失)
同时,会生成一个直方图。
1.2 代码解释
- 第一行:
numpy.random.randn函数创建一个包含90,000个浮点数的一维数组,这些数遵循均值为0、方差为1的正态分布。 - 第二行:
hist函数接受一个数组作为参数,计算并绘制该数组的直方图。它有许多可选参数,这里我们指定了使用的区间数量。
超级会员免费看
订阅专栏 解锁全文
1070

被折叠的 条评论
为什么被折叠?



